This sweet home is quirky and just loaded with charm and will suit anyone from a free-spirited single to a small family to a retired couple. Built sometime around the 60s, it retains its cute cottage style but has enjoyed some renovations over the years and recently fully decorated. Aside from the main home, a 38sqm studio is a nifty addition and can be used for art, exercise, a games room, or as a guest room. Plus there's a super cute teen pad with veranda.
The living area of this home is warm and inviting. Timber floors and fresh paint ramp up the charm, and the cosy wood fire will ensure winter is your favourite time of year. A gorgeous study nook offers views of the garden - the sounds and sights of nature will keep you calm during study or work and will also offer some respite from stressful moments. To really chill out, grab a good book and retreat to the bathroom for a soak in the beautiful deep bathtub. Bliss.
